Understanding Business Regulations in Indonesia: Indonesia has a comprehensive legal system that governs business operations, including regulations related to compensation and claims. The Indonesian legal system is a civil law system, influenced by Dutch and customary law. Key legislations that address compensation and claims include the Indonesian Civil Code, Law on Tort, and the Law on Consumer Protection. When it comes to seeking legal compensation and making claims in Indonesia, businesses and individuals must navigate the specific regulations that apply to their case. Understanding the legal provisions, time limits, and procedural requirements is essential to pursuing a successful claim. Mapping Out Your Path to Justice: Navigating the legal process for seeking compensation and making claims in Indonesia can be daunting, especially for those unfamiliar with the legal system. Here are some steps to help you map out your path to justice: 1. Consult with Legal Experts: Seeking advice from legal experts who are well-versed in Indonesian business regulations and compensation laws is crucial. A knowledgeable lawyer can provide guidance on the legal framework, assess the strength of your case, and help you navigate the complexities of the legal process. 2. Gather Evidence: Building a strong case requires thorough documentation and evidence to support your claim. Collect relevant documents, contracts, receipts, and any other evidence that substantiates your case. 3. Initiate Legal Proceedings: Depending on the nature of your claim, you may need to initiate legal proceedings through the appropriate channels, such as mediation, arbitration, or court litigation. Understanding the relevant procedures and timelines is essential to moving your case forward. 4. Negotiate Settlement: In some cases, parties may opt for settlement negotiations to resolve the dispute amicably. Understanding your rights and options during negotiations is key to reaching a fair and equitable resolution.
